High alertness adopted at Mahakali coastal areas



KANCHANPUR: High alert has been adopted in the coastal areas along the Mahakali River in Kanchanpur district after the sluice gates of the dam of Dhauliganga hydropower project at Tapoban, Dharchula, of Uttarakhand Province in India have been opened.

The sluice gates are opened for silt flushing process.

Deputy Superintendent of Police at the District Police Office, Kanchanpur, Chakra Bahadur Shah, said locals of the Mahakali River coastal area have been urged to adopt precautions as there is a possibility of increase in water level in the Mahakali River as the sluice gates of the dam are opened.

NHPC Limited of India informed that the sluice gates are to remain open from 5:00 am to 8:00 pm on Friday.
